CSDN-Ada助手 2023-05-25 18:31 采纳率: 1.6%
浏览 27

怎样将日期转为yyyy/mm/dd hh:mi:ss ?

该问题来自社区帖: https://bbs.csdn.net/topics/615536298.为符合问答规范, 该问题经过ChatGPT优化
怎样将日期转为yyyy/mm/dd hh:mi:ss ?

以下代码可以将当前时间转为格式为yyyy/mm/dd的字符串:

```sql SELECT CONVERT(varchar(10), GETDATE(), 111) AS date_str ```

如果想要将时间也包含在字符串中,可以使用以下代码:

```sql SELECT CONVERT(varchar(19), GETDATE(), 120) AS datetime_str ```

其中,120是转换代码,具体含义如下:

代码含义示例
101mm/dd/yyyy05/25/2023
102yyyy.mm.dd2023.05.25
110yyyy-mm-dd2023-05-25
111yyyy/mm/dd2023/05/25
120yyyy-mm-dd hh:mi:ss(24h)2023-05-25 18:22:52
121yyyy-mm-dd hh:mi:ss.mmm(24h)2023-05-25 18:22:52.000

其中,hh:mi:ss用于表示时分秒,24h代表24小时制。

  • 写回答

2条回答 默认 最新

  • 码上团建 2023-05-25 19:25
    关注

    通过你的问题,我大概理解的是,sql如何转换日期,mysql 可以使用 DATE_FORMAT()函数来实现:

    SELECT DATE_FORMAT(NOW(), '%Y-%m-%d %H:%i:%s');
    
    

    以此类推,其他都可以这样转换;'%Y-%m-%d %H:%i:%s'表示四位年份、月份、日期、小时、分钟和秒以连字符分隔。

    评论

报告相同问题?

问题事件

  • 创建了问题 5月25日

悬赏问题

  • ¥50 永磁型步进电机PID算法
  • ¥15 sqlite 附加(attach database)加密数据库时,返回26是什么原因呢?
  • ¥88 找成都本地经验丰富懂小程序开发的技术大咖
  • ¥15 如何处理复杂数据表格的除法运算
  • ¥15 如何用stc8h1k08的片子做485数据透传的功能?(关键词-串口)
  • ¥15 有兄弟姐妹会用word插图功能制作类似citespace的图片吗?
  • ¥200 uniapp长期运行卡死问题解决
  • ¥15 latex怎么处理论文引理引用参考文献
  • ¥15 请教:如何用postman调用本地虚拟机区块链接上的合约?
  • ¥15 为什么使用javacv转封装rtsp为rtmp时出现如下问题:[h264 @ 000000004faf7500]no frame?